Catching the Torch: Nov. 18-24 Edition

The Three Stars

1. G Dustin Tokarski

Leading off the Three Stars this week, Hamilton Bulldogs netminder Dustin Tokarski has seen fit to reward the Hamilton Bulldogs after establishing him as their starting goalie. Tokarski would begin his week with a 30-save performance versus the Texas Stars as the Bulldogs would rout the Stars in a 5-1 victory. He would appear just as brilliant in the following game, as he would make 25 stops in a special appearance as the Hamilton Bulldogs took to the Bell Centre ice against the Syracuse Crunch, allowing the Bulldogs to take a 4-1 victory. His best work was saved for the following night, as the Bulldogs would visit Syracuse at home and he would put on an outstanding 43-save performance for the first shutout of his season. Tokarski would finish the week with a .67 Goals Against Average and a .980 save percentage, which raised his season statistics to a 1.91 Goals Against Average and a .935 save percentage, his record is now 8-3-1 over 12 starts. Tokarski is 2nd in the AHL in Goals Against Average, 3rd in Save Percentage. Dustin Tokarski was drafted in the 5th round, 122nd overall by the Tampa Bay Lightning in the 2008 NHL Draft and was acquired by the Montreal Canadiens in exchange for Cedrick Desjardins.

2. LW Charles Hudon

ThWhile he has not had a dazzling offensive season so far in the QMJHL, it seems the prospect of representating his country in an international setting has fired up Charles Hudon. Hudon began the week playing in the QMJHL segment of the Super Series, featuring top Russian junior skaters versus the best Canadian players in the QMJHL. He would score two goals and assist on the eventual game-winning goal in a 3-2 victory for Team QMJHL over Team Russia. He would mark an assist in the following game, as Team QMJHL edged a 4-3 result to sweep their 2-game set. Upon his return to the Chicoutimi Saguenéens, Hudon would mark one of his finest games to date in the QMJHL. In a dominant 6-3 victory over the Charlottetown Islanders, he would score two goals and three assists, the first five-point game in his QMJHL career. He would miss out on the scoresheet in his final game of the week, a 2-0 loss for Chicoutimi to the Moncton Wildcats. Hudon currently leads Chicoutimi in scoring with 29 points. Charles Hudon was drafted in the 5th round, 122nd overall by the Montreal Canadiens in the 2013 NHL Draft.

3. G Zach Fucale

The workhorse netminder of the Halifax Mooseheads Zach Fucale has been on a hot streak of late and it has translated to some impressive statistics. Fucale would start his first game of the week in nets for Team QMJHL in the Super Series, featuring top Russian junior skaters versus the best Canadian players in the QMJHL. He would make 19 saves on 21 shots as Team QMJHL would edge a 3-2 victory over Russia. His return to the Halifax Mooseheads would see him maintain his excellence, as he would make 25 saves on 27 shots as the Mooseheads would rout the Acadie-Bathurst Titan 9-2. He would take his game further the following night, pitching a 22-save shutout against the Saint John Sea Dogs. Including the Super Series game, Fucale’s save percentage for the week comes out to an impressive .943 and a 1.33 Goals Against Average. Fucale is 4th in the QMJHL in Goals Against Average at 2.62 and 11th in save percentage at .897 while holding a 17-5-0 record. Zach Fucale was drafted in the 2nd round, 36th overall by the Montreal Canadiens in the 2013 NHL Draft.
